CONNECTION DIAGRAMS

Modbus RS485 Port: This port is for communicating
with the RSTC1000 using the Modbus RTU protocol
over a 2-wire or 4-wire RS485 physical layer (Refer to
Figure 1).

Communication Indicator: Yellow indicator, visible
through top cover, will illuminate whenever the
RSTC1000 communicates over the RS485 port.

Communication Error Indicator: Red indicator,
visible through top cover, will illuminate whenever the
RSTC1000 detects an error with a received message.

Termination resistors added externally

- Recommend 150

Ω, 0.5 W

LTR = User supplied line termination resistor

Cable Recommendation:
-

Shielded

- 24 awg is always suffi cient

- 4 wire system, 1000 m (9600 baud)

- 2 wire system, 500 m (9600 baud)
